A Study of Entresto in Tetralogy of Fallot (TOF) and Ebstein's Anomaly (EA)
Recruiting
The purpose of this study is to compare changes in RV structure and function, biomarkers, and patient reported outcomes between TOF patients randomized to an ARNI vs placebo.

Randomized Double-Blind Placebo-Controlled Adaptive Design Trial Of Intrathecally Administered Autologous Mesenchymal Stem Cells In Multiple System Atrophy
Recruiting
Multiple system atrophy (MSA) is a rare, rapidly progressive, and invariably fatal neurological condition characterized by autonomic failure, parkinsonism, and/or ataxia. There is no available treatment to slow or halt disease progression. The purpose of this study is to assess optimal dosing frequency, effectiveness and safety of adipose-derived autologous mesenchymal stem cells delivered into the spinal fluid of patients with MSA.

A Study of Pyridostigmine in Postural Tachycardia Syndrome
Recruiting
This is a 3-day study comparing pyridostigmine versus placebo in the treatment of postural tachycardia syndrome (POTS). The researchers expect pyridostigmine to improve tachycardia and stabilize blood pressure.
